The Hidden Costs of Fragmented Systems in the Pool Industry 💡
As a busy executive, you know the feeling: your technicians are in the field, your retail store is busy, and your construction crew is on site. Yet, getting a clear, real-time picture of profitability is nearly impossible. This is the reality of the 'messy middle' of operations, often caused by relying on non-integrated software or manual processes. The cost of this fragmentation is often hidden, but it's substantial.
Consider the following common pain points and their direct impact on your bottom line:
| Core Pain Point | Operational Symptom | Quantified Business Impact |
|---|---|---|
| Manual Scheduling & Dispatch | Technicians driving inefficient routes, missed appointments. | 10-15% increase in fuel/labor costs; reduced service capacity. |
| Disjointed Inventory Control | Stockouts of critical chemicals/parts, overstocking of slow-moving items. | Up to 20% loss in potential revenue from delayed repairs; increased carrying costs. |
| Delayed/Inaccurate Invoicing | Service data not immediately transferred to the accounting team. | Increased Days Sales Outstanding (DSO); cash flow strain. |
| Lack of Customer History | Inability to quickly access service history, chemical readings, or warranty details. | Lower customer satisfaction; increased liability risk; lost upsell opportunities. |

The Power of Integration: FSM Meets ERP
When your FSM module is natively integrated with your ERP, the following efficiencies are unlocked:
- Automated Billing: Once a job is marked complete in the field, an invoice is automatically generated and sent, drastically improving cash flow.
- Real-Time Inventory Drawdown: Parts and chemicals used on-site are immediately deducted from warehouse inventory, triggering reorder alerts and ensuring accurate stock levels.
- Seamless CRM software Updates: Every service interaction, quote, and customer note is instantly logged in the customer's profile, empowering sales and support teams.

To truly master your operations, your software solution must provide deep functionality across four critical areas. These modules, when integrated, form the backbone of a high-performing pool business.
Field Service Management (FSM) & Route Optimization
This is the lifeblood of a service-based pool company. Key features include drag-and-drop scheduling, GPS tracking, mobile access for technicians (including photo/signature capture), and intelligent route optimization to minimize drive time. The goal is to maximize the number of service stops per day while reducing fuel costs.
Financial Management and Invoicing
Accurate and timely billing is non-negotiable. Your financial management software must handle recurring billing for maintenance contracts, integrate with POS for retail sales, and provide real-time profit and loss statements. This module is crucial for compliance and strategic financial planning.
Customer Relationship Management (CRM)
A dedicated CRM module tracks every customer interaction, from the initial lead for a new pool build to annual service renewals. It allows for targeted marketing campaigns (e.g., winterization reminders) and ensures that every team member has the full customer history, fostering loyalty and driving repeat business.
Inventory and Supply Chain Management
Managing pool chemicals, equipment, and construction materials is complex. The software must support multiple warehouses (including truck stock), track lot numbers for chemicals, and provide predictive reordering based on service demand. This prevents costly stockouts and minimizes waste.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the primary difference between pool service software and a full ERP?
Pool service software (often FSM) typically focuses on scheduling, dispatch, and basic invoicing. A full ERP (Enterprise Resource Planning) is a comprehensive system that integrates FSM with core business functions like Financials, Accounting, Inventory Management, and CRM. The ERP provides a single source of truth and a holistic view of the business, which is essential for scalable growth.
